King oyster mushrooms (Pleurotus eryngii), native to the Mediterranean region and parts of Asia, are prized for their meaty texture and savory umami flavor, making them a popular choice in vegetarian and vegan cuisine. These mushrooms are versatile, used in dishes such as stir-fries, soups, and grilled preparations. Nutritionally, king oyster mushrooms are low in calories, with only about 35 calories per 100 grams, and contain roughly 3 grams of protein, 6 grams of carbohydrates, and nearly no fat. They are a good source of dietary fiber, potassium, phosphorus, and B vitamins like niacin (B3) and pantothenic acid (B5). Additionally, they have a high water content, making them hydrating and filling while being low in energy density.
Store fresh king oyster mushrooms in a paper bag in the refrigerator to maintain freshness, and consume them within a week. Avoid washing until just before cooking to prevent them from becoming slimy.
King oyster mushrooms contain about 3 grams of protein per 100 grams, making them a moderate source of plant-based protein. They are not as high in protein as legumes or tofu, but they can be an excellent addition to meals for variety in a balanced diet.
Yes, king oyster mushrooms are keto-friendly as they are low in carbohydrates, providing just 1-2 grams of net carbs per 100 grams. Their meaty texture makes them a great substitute for higher-carb ingredients in keto recipes.
King oyster mushrooms are rich in antioxidants, vitamins like B5 and D, and minerals such as potassium. They may support heart health, aid digestion due to their fiber content, and boost immune function. Their low calorie and fat content make them a healthy choice for weight management.
A typical serving size is about 100 grams, which is roughly one large mushroom or a few smaller ones. This provides around 30 calories, making it easy to incorporate into meals without significantly impacting caloric intake.
King oyster mushrooms have a firmer, meatier texture compared to the softer consistency of shiitake mushrooms. Nutritionally, king oyster mushrooms are lower in calories and fat, while shiitake mushrooms offer slightly more protein and additional compounds like eritadenine that may support cholesterol management.
